Artificial Intelligence (AI) and Machine Learning (ML): The Driving Forces of Innovation
AI and ML are no longer futuristic concepts; they are integral parts of our current technological landscape. AI's ability to mimic human intelligence and ML's capacity to learn from data are transforming how we interact with technology. Consider the following applications:
- Autonomous Vehicles: Self-driving cars are becoming increasingly sophisticated, relying on AI and ML to navigate roads and make real-time decisions.
- Healthcare: AI-powered diagnostic tools are improving accuracy and speed in disease detection, while personalized medicine is leveraging ML to tailor treatments to individual patients.
- Finance: Algorithmic trading, fraud detection, and risk management are all being enhanced by AI and ML, leading to greater efficiency and security.
The ethical implications of AI are also crucial considerations. Issues such as bias in algorithms, job displacement due to automation, and the potential for misuse need careful examination and proactive solutions.
The Metaverse: Immersive Experiences and New Possibilities
The metaverse is a concept that envisions a persistent, shared, 3D virtual world where users can interact with each other and digital objects. While still in its early stages, the metaverse holds immense potential for:
- Gaming and Entertainment: Immersive gaming experiences and virtual concerts are just the beginning. The metaverse offers new ways to interact with entertainment content.
- Social Interaction: The metaverse provides opportunities for virtual socializing, bridging geographical distances and facilitating communication.
- Education and Training: Virtual simulations and immersive learning environments can revolutionize education and training across various fields.
- Commerce: Virtual shopping experiences and digital marketplaces are transforming e-commerce, offering new possibilities for interaction and engagement.
However, challenges remain. Interoperability between different metaverse platforms, data privacy concerns, and the need for robust infrastructure are key obstacles that need to be addressed for the metaverse to reach its full potential.
Web3: Decentralization and the Future of the Internet
Web3 represents a paradigm shift from the centralized internet we know today towards a decentralized, user-owned model. Key technologies driving Web3 include blockchain, cryptocurrencies, and decentralized autonomous organizations (DAOs).
- Decentralized Applications (dApps): These applications operate on blockchain technology, eliminating the need for intermediaries and empowering users with greater control over their data.
- NFTs (Non-Fungible Tokens): NFTs are digital assets representing ownership of unique items, creating new opportunities for creators and collectors.
- The Metaverse Connection: Web3 technologies are foundational to the development of the metaverse, providing the infrastructure for secure and decentralized virtual worlds.
Web3's promise of increased transparency, security, and user control is significant. Yet, scalability, regulatory challenges, and the potential for misuse are crucial factors to consider.
The Internet of Things (IoT) and Smart Devices
The IoT connects everyday devices to the internet, enabling communication and data exchange. Smart homes, wearables, and smart cities are just some examples of IoT applications. IoT is driving increased efficiency, automation, and data-driven decision-making across numerous industries. However, security and privacy concerns are paramount, as interconnected devices create vulnerabilities that need to be addressed.
